Darwinia coming to Xbox Live Arcade News
Xbox 360 News by Ellie Gibson
Introversion has confirmed rumours that PC hit Darwinia is on the way to Xbox Live Arcade.
It'll come bundled with an XBLA version of the forthcoming sequel, Multiwinia: Survival of the Flattest. The titles will be released as a bundle under the name Darwinia+ and will be available this autumn.
"When we first started Introversion back in 2001, the idea of developing our games for a console seemed an impossible challenge," said Introversion's Chris Delay.
"Whilst we have built a fantastic community around our PC games, and will continue to support that, it has always been our dream to take the next step and produce a console title."
